### Migration Step 4: Enable the Circuit Breaker for the Meridex Upstream API

Before flipping the breaker flag, confirm that fallback reads are wired to the replica cluster. The breaker records trip events in the `breaker_audit` table, which the weekly sync reviews for tuning thresholds. Deploy the config change, then verify the audit table is receiving writes by connecting to the replica with the following connection string.

replica DSN, kajep-yahag: mssql://praok_svc:iF@db-8d68.plorvaio.local:5432/eliion

# Turnstile counter service — Halverd Stadium, release env
# Owner: gate-ops. Release manager: verify before each cutover.
# COUNT_FLUSH_SEC stays at 5; lower values overload the Merrow relay.
# GATE_IDS must match the physical layout sheet for the east stands.
# Stale counts usually mean a wrong relay host, not auth.
# The relay requires a signing secret; append its line immediately below.

sealed setting: RELAY_SECRET3=3af

Quarterly Planning Note — Closure of the Dunmoor Office

For sales leads, ahead of Q4 planning. We will close the Dunmoor satellite office at the end of the quarter. The five-person team transfers to the Calder Hill site, with remote arrangements offered where relocation is impractical. Client accounts served from Dunmoor move to the central desk; please flag any relationships needing a personal handover by month-end. Projected annual savings are modest but meaningful. The strategic reasoning behind this decision is set out below.

confidential, bafop-kahag: Gross margin on Ulawyn came in at 15 percent against a plan of 10 percent. Only 5 of the 80 pilot accounts renewed Ulawyn, so a churn review is set for January 1.

### Step 4: Resolve calendar sync conflicts

After upgrading to Meadowlark 3.2, some users will see duplicate events where the old sync agent and the new one both wrote entries. Run the dedupe tool once per affected account; it keeps the newer record. The tool reads its conflict-resolution settings from the sync service, which currently holds these values:

deployment values, kajep-kageg:
[praix]
host = praix.paliqcorp.corp
user = praix_svc
database = praix_prod